Flake Music

    On November 24th, Sub Pop Records will reissue the debut album from James Mercer’s pre-Shins band Flake Music. In anticipation,You Land Here, It’s Time to Return is streaming in full via NPR.org.

    The 12-track album originally saw a limited release in 1997 through Omnibus Records. For the reissue, Mercer enlisted Broken Bells collaborator Kennie Takahashi to mix the album and J.J. Golden (La Sera, Charles Bradley) for the remaster. The reissue also features newly updated artwork.

    “So cool to hear this record now with a proper mix,” Mercer recently told Rolling Stone. “We worked hard on these songs and finally we feel like they’ve been fully realized. Bask in the Nineties glow of our summers passed.”
